比特币自2009年面世以来,作为一种去中心化的数字货币,引起了全球范围内的热烈讨论。其中,比特币钱包作为用户存储和管理比特币的工具,其开发与演变历程同样至关重要。本文将深入探讨比特币钱包是谁做的、开发背景以及相关的技术与人物。同时,我们也将尝试回答一些与比特币钱包相关的重要问题。
比特币钱包的历史沿革
比特币钱包的概念随着比特币的出现而诞生。比特币的创建者“中本聪”(Satoshi Nakamoto)在发布比特币网络和第一个客户端软件时,同时也开发了最初的比特币钱包软件。这个钱包让用户能够生成比特币地址,接受和发送比特币。这一最早版本的钱包实现了区块链技术的基本功能,但其安全性和用户体验都相对较为初级。
随着比特币的普及,用户对比特币钱包功能与安全的需求也逐渐提高,许多开发者开始着手创建新的钱包应用。2011年,第一个第三方比特币钱包“Blockchain.info”上线,用户可以通过浏览器直接使用钱包,提供了比特币管理的便利性。
此后,不同类型的钱包陆续问世,包括桌面钱包、移动钱包、硬件钱包和纸质钱包等。例如,2014年,Trezor推出了全球首个硬件钱包,提供离线存储比特币的安全选项。每种钱包的背后都凝聚着不同开发者的智慧和努力。
比特币钱包的工作原理

比特币钱包的基本工作原理是通过私钥和公钥的配对来管理用户的比特币余额。用户的比特币地址实际上是公钥的哈希值,而私钥则是其唯一的安全凭证。
当用户发送比特币时,钱包会使用私钥对交易进行签名,以证明用户拥有发送比特币的权利。这一过程通过比特币网络将交易广播出去,经过矿工的验证后,交易会被记录到区块链上。
正因如此,钱包的类型多样化为用户提供了不同的安全级别和便捷性。综合考虑用户的需求,钱包开发者希望提升安全性、易用性和访问速度。
比特币钱包中存在的风险
尽管比特币钱包为用户提供了管理数字资产的便捷,但同时也面临诸多安全风险,其中包括黑客攻击、用户失误和恶意软件等。这些风险各有特点,给用户的资产安全带来了挑战。
首先,黑客攻击是一种常见威胁。许多集中式钱包因其服务器存储大量私钥而成为攻击的目标。用户使用硬件钱包或冷钱包可以降低这种风险。
其次,用户失误也可能导致失去资产。例如,如果用户遗失了存储私钥的位置,或因忘记密码而无法 toegang 到钱包,就可能面临比特币被永久锁定的局面。因此,对于用户来说,安全备份和私钥保护尤为重要。
选择比特币钱包时的考虑因素

在选择合适的比特币钱包时,用户需要考虑多个因素,包括安全性、便捷性、功能性和可用性等。不同钱包类型适合不同用户,以及使用场景。
安全性是选择钱包的首要考虑因素。硬件钱包提供了最高的安全级别,而软件钱包可能存在一定的在线风险。用户需要权衡安全性与便利性,选择合适的钱包类型。
便捷性也是很多用户关注的重点。移动钱包便于随时随地管理资产,而桌面钱包适合频繁交易或大金额的资产管理。此外,用户应选择界面友好、操作简单的钱包软件,防止因复杂操作导致错误。
功能性也是选择的关键。例如,有些钱包支持多种加密货币,有些则提供借记卡服务和加密贷款等功能。用户需根据自己的需求做出合适选择。
常见问题解答
比特币钱包的私钥是怎样生成的?
私钥是由一组随机数字生成的,通常使用加密哈希算法来确保其安全性。具体生成过程包括:
1. 随机数生成:首先,系统会通过随机数生成器生成一个256位的随机数。这是私钥的基础,只有拥有这个私钥的用户才能控制相应的比特币。
2. 哈希算法:生成的随机数随后经过SHA-256哈希算法处理,这一过程将会产生一个看似随机的输出,这就是私钥。
3. 钱包地址生成:私钥通过一定的计算过程生成公钥,而公钥经过哈希处理后,就成为用户的比特币地址。用户可以通过公钥接收比特币,而私钥则用来进行支出操作。惟有临存私钥,用户才能对此比特币进行任何操作。
简而言之,私钥的生成是高度随机的,保证了比特币钱包的安全性。给用户带来的好处是,因为每一个私钥都是唯一的,因此不会有人能够随意生成出同样的私钥来控制别人的比特币资产。
比特币钱包软件的安全性如何评估?
钱包的安全性评估通常可以从多个角度进行,这里列举一些关键指标:
1. 加密技术:高质量的钱包应用会采用最新的加密技术对用户数据进行保护,例如使用AES加密和多重签名等,以提高安全性。
2. 备份机制:优秀的钱包会提供备份选项,使用户可以在设备丢失或者软件故障时恢复自己的资产。用户应选择有备份和恢复功能的钱包。
3. 代码审计:开放源代码的钱包可以得到社区的审计,及时发现和修复安全漏洞。而封闭源代码的应用可能难以评估其真正的安全性。
4. 用户反馈与口碑:可以参考社区评价和用户反馈,了解该钱包的安全性以及用户体验,从而对钱包的安全性进行评估。
为什么需要备份比特币钱包?
备份比特币钱包是保障用户资产安全的重要手段。其主要原因包括:
1. 防止数据丢失:设备故障、丢失或损坏都可能导致用户无法访问其钱包。而备份可以将私钥安全存储在其他位置,确保用户能随时找回资产。
2. 解脱密码忘记的风险:很多用户可能因为忘记密码而导致钱包无法访问。通过备份,用户可以在恢复失去的数据时得到保障。
3. 防止病毒或者恶意软件攻击:在设备受恶意软件感染时,用户可能失去对钱包的控制。备份能够确保用户在恢复系统后,依然能够访问他们的数字资产。
4. 平台迁移:用户可能会选择切换钱包提供商,或者切换到不同平台,以获得更好的功能和服务。备份使这一过程变得更方便,用户可以在新平台轻松恢复资产。
不同类型的比特币钱包对用户的适用性如何?
比特币钱包可大致分为热钱包和冷钱包。热钱包连接互联网,适合频繁交易的用户;冷钱包则是离线存储,适合长期安全存储资产。
热钱包例如:移动钱包和桌面钱包,方便用户快速访问和交易。从便利性来讲,热钱包适合日常交易,用户能够方便地管理资产,随时进行转账。
冷钱包如硬件钱包和纸质钱包,无法与互联网连接,提供了更高的安全性。尤其适合长期持有比特币的用户,这类用户希望将其资产储存于更安全的环境,降低被黑客攻击的风险。
此外,部分用户可能选择使用多种类型的钱包。比如:将常用的比特币储存在热钱包中进行日常交易,同时将大部分资产存放在冷钱包中以确保安全,这是一种合理的资产管理策略。
通过以上分析,我们对比特币钱包的开发背景、功能原理、安全性及其选择有了更深入的理解。每个用户都应认真对待比特币的管理,深入学习如何选择和使用比特币钱包,务必确保其数字资产的安全。